The city museum complex covers archaeology, natural history and art, making it the best introduction to Reggio Emilia’s heritage.
Museum dedicated to the Italian tricolour, housed in the hall where the flag was adopted in 1797.

Fresh egg pasta parcels stuffed with chard, spinach, Parmigiano Reggiano and herbs, often served with butter and sage. A defining festive dish of Reggio Emilia.
A savoury pie of chard or spinach, Parmigiano Reggiano, onion and lard baked in thin pastry. It is one of Reggio Emilia’s most emblematic street and home foods.
Small fresh pasta squares traditionally filled with pumpkin, amaretti and Parmigiano Reggiano, balancing sweet and savoury flavours typical of Emilia.
